Biggest waterfall in world2/28/2024 ![]() The month of September offers cooler temperatures and is ideal for hiking at Yosemite Falls.Īlso Read: 11 Must-Visit National Parks in the United States 6. ![]() ![]() Yosemite Falls are located in California’s Yosemite National Park which is home to five of the world’s highest waterfalls, as well as 300 lakes, meadows, and sequoia forests.Īddress: Yosemite Village, CA 95389, United Statesīest Time To Visit: Late May and early June is the best time to view Yosemite Falls, roaring from freshly melted snow. The Yosemite Falls are made up of three separate falls that make a 2,425-foot drop, creating stunning lunar rainbows (called moonbows). Created by the Zambezi River, Victoria Falls is also one of the seven natural wonders of the world.Īddress: Mosi-o-tunya Road, Livingstone, Zambiaīest Time To Visit: The best time to visit Victoria Falls is from February to May, directly after the region’s summer rains.Īlso Read: Be Amazed at the Seven Natural Wonders of the World 5. Victoria Falls also possesses the world’s largest sheet of falling water. Located in southern Africa, Victoria Falls is on the border of Zambia and Zimbabwe. Victoria Falls - Zimbabwe And ZambiaĪt 350 feet, Victoria Falls is twice the height of North America’s Niagara Falls. In the winter, if you’re lucky, you might be able to see Niagara Falls completely frozen.Īddress: 6650 Niagara Parkway, Niagara Fallsīest Time To Visit: The best time to visit Niagara Falls is from June to August. In the summer there are various boat tours and the Clifton Hill SkyWheel at Niagara Falls. Each season brings something new to this popular attraction. More than 750,000 gallons of water flow through Niagra Falls every second. Situated on the border of two countries, Niagra Falls is actually three large waterfalls that straddle the international border between the Canadian province of Ontario and the American state of New York. It is also one of the most iconic sights in Iceland and is part of the “Golden Circle” of tourist sites, which also includes the Þingvellir National Park and the geothermal area in Haukadalur.Īddress: It is located in the canyon of the Hvítá River in southwest Iceland.īest Time To Visit: Any season will be great to visit the waterfalls. This gives rise to the name Gullfoss (or golden falls). The waterfalls, fed by the Hvítá River, cascade over 150 feet into a gaping gorge, and in the summer, the sun shines through the billowing spray, giving it a golden hue. They were used in Marvel’s ‘Black Panther’ as Warrior Falls in the fictional African country of Wakanda.īest Time To Visit: The best months to see the Iguazu Falls are April (except Easter Days), May, September, and October. Together, they form a system of the biggest waterfall in the world. There are over 270 waterfalls in total, the tallest of which is called ‘Devil’s Throat’. The Iguazu River which forms the falls creates part of the boundary between the two countries. Nearly 300 feet tall and more than 1.5 miles wide, the Iguazu Falls are located between Argentina and Brazil. The Most Beautiful And Famous Waterfalls In The World 1.
